Desde que embarcou no navio
Eu te vi e você nem me viu
Quanto encanto vi em seu olhar
Se foi o destino eu não sei
As 20 horas eu te encontrei
E te convidei pra jantar

Depois da sobremesa
Foi eu você e o vinho
Voltei do mar
E já não to mais sozinho

A nossa história começou no mar
E vai continuar onde a gente for
No céu ou na terra
Nessa ilha deserta
Aqui nesse altar eu te prometo amor
